Pricing Info
Pricing Info
Whale offers pricing plans for various business scales. Contact the vendor to sign up and book a demo.
Forever Free – $0/month
- Rich Media Editor
- Template Gallery
- Built-in Screen Recorder
- Google and OneDrive Integration
- Whale AI Assist
- Browser Extension
Essentials – $10/month
- Everything in Free+
- Unlimited Boards
- Custom Branding
- Groups and Permissions
- Tag Manager
- Version History
Scale – $15/month
- Everything in Essentials+
- Training Flows
- Quizzes
- Contextual Suggestions
- Auto Translate
- QR Codes
Enterprise – By quote
- Everything in Scale+
- HRIS Integrations
- SCIM
- API Access
- Unlimited Workspaces
- Professional Services Included

Zoho RPA offers two pricing plans tailored to different automation needs. Here’s a breakdown:
Free Plan
- Price: $0/month
- RPA Flow Executions: 3 per month
- Active RPA Flows: 1
- History Retention: 30 days
- Features:
- Windows automation
- Web automation
- MS Excel automation
- Files and folders automation
- Schedule and webhook triggers
- Drag-and-drop builder
- Basic logic utilities (e.g., decision, delay, set variable)
Standard Plan
- Price: $49/month (monthly billing) or $44/month (annual billing)
- RPA Flow Executions: 500 per month
- Active RPA Flows: Unlimited
- History Retention: 90 days
- Additional Features:
- All features from the Free Plan
- Additional triggers (hotkey, file/folder events, Windows process)
- Advanced builder tools (undo/redo, drafts, versioning)
- Custom functions
- DevOps capabilities (manual/auto rerun)
- Audit trail and flow restoration
- Enhanced security (encryption at rest, GDPR compliance, MFA)
Add-Ons
If you require more than 500 executions per month, Zoho offers additional execution packs:
- 100 executions/month
- 500 executions/month
- 1000 executions/month
These add-ons can be purchased based on your specific needs.
Cloud App Integrations
To automate tasks across over 900 cloud applications, Zoho RPA integrates with Zoho Flow. Please note that a separate Zoho Flow subscription is required, and actions performed through Zoho Flow count against its limits, not Zoho RPA’s.
Integrations
- 900+ Cloud Applications: Zoho RPA provides pre-built tasks for over 900 cloud apps, enabling immediate automation without extensive development.
- Legacy and Desktop Applications: The platform can automate tasks in legacy systems and desktop applications, even those without APIs, by mimicking user interactions.
- Web Applications: Zoho RPA supports automation across various web platforms and browsers, including Chrome, Firefox, Edge, and Zoho’s own Ulaa browser.
- Windows Applications: It interacts with Windows-based applications, automating repetitive tasks to streamline business processes.
- Excel Automation: Zoho RPA can automate tasks in Microsoft Excel, such as data entry, report generation, and data manipulation.
- Files and Folders: The platform automates file management tasks, including renaming, copying, moving, and organizing files and folders.
- Custom Functions: For scenarios where out-of-the-box integrations fall short, Zoho RPA provides the flexibility to create custom automation logic through custom functions using Deluge.
